Well, "It Sucks to be Me" would be fitting for the children...

Showtunes about death, though...
*"Every Day a Little Death" - "A Little Night Music"
*"Come to Me" and "A Little Fall of Rain" - "Les Miserables"
*"She is a Diamond", "Eva's Final Broadcast", and "Montage - Lament" - "Evita"
*"Alabanza" and "Everything I Know" - "In the Heights"
*"No One is Alone" - "Into the Woods"
*"I'll Cover You (Reprise)" and "Goodbye Love" - "Rent"
